
Finding virtual golf near you is easier than it seems, thanks to the growing number of venues offering immersive golf simulators. These facilities allow players to practice and play on realistic courses regardless of weather or time. Virtual golf locations can be found in specialized entertainment centers, sports clubs, and even some bars or restaurants.
Customers often search online directories or map services to locate nearby virtual golf spots, filtering by distance, amenities, and pricing. Many venues provide options for casual play, practice sessions, or competitive leagues, catering to a range of skill levels.
Whether someone wants to improve their swing or enjoy a round with friends indoors, virtual golf offers a convenient alternative to traditional courses. Exploring local listings will reveal the best places that fit their needs and schedule.

Choosing the Right Virtual Golf Experience
Selecting a virtual golf venue involves evaluating the quality of technology and simulator capabilities alongside the convenience and cost of booking options. Both factors significantly affect the user’s satisfaction and overall experience.
Technology and Simulator Features
The most important aspect is the simulator’s accuracy in tracking shots. High-end systems use infrared sensors, radar, or high-speed cameras to deliver realistic ball flight data and swing analysis. Some offer 3D course graphics and various weather conditions for immersion.
Screen size and resolution also matter for visibility. Larger, high-definition displays reduce eye strain and improve engagement. Additionally, adjustable settings for player skill level and multiplayer modes enhance usability for different users.
Sound quality and space are often overlooked but critical. Clear audio, including ambient golf sounds, adds realism. A spacious setup prevents interference during swings and allows for natural movement.
Booking and Pricing Options
Ease of booking can influence frequency of use. Many venues provide online reservations with real-time availability. Walk-in options are less reliable but may suit casual users.
Pricing usually depends on session length, time of day, and group size. Some places charge by the hour, while others offer packages or memberships. Comparing these can identify the best value.
Additional fees may apply for equipment rental or coaching sessions. Clear information on cancellation policies and deposit requirements helps avoid surprises.
